Meaning of "parliamentary reform"

Parliamentary reform refers to changes or modifications made to the structure, rules, and procedures of a parliament or legislative body. It aims to improve transparency, efficiency, and representation within the political system. These reforms can include changes to electoral systems, committee structures, and decision-making processes, among other aspects
